#0d6194 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#0d6194 is composed of 5.1% red, 38% green and 58%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 91.2% cyan, 34.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 42% black. It has a hue angle of 202.7 degrees, a saturation of 83.9% and a lightness of 31.6%. #0d6194 color hex could be obtained by blending #1ac2ff with #000029. Closest websafe color is: #006699.

#0d6194 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#0d6194 has RGB values of R:13, G:97, B:148 and CMYK values of C:0.91, M:0.34, Y:0, K:0.42. Its decimal value is 876948.

Hex triplet 0d6194 #0d6194
RGB Decimal 13, 97, 148 rgb(13,97,148)
RGB Percent 5.1, 38, 58 rgb(5.1%,38%,58%)
CMYK 91, 34, 0, 42
HSL 202.7°, 83.9, 31.6 hsl(202.7,83.9%,31.6%)
HSV (or HSB) 202.7°, 91.2, 58
Web Safe 006699 #006699
CIE-LAB 39.194, -3.569, -34.368
XYZ 9.785, 10.772, 29.579
xyY 0.195, 0.215, 10.772
CIE-LCH 39.194, 34.553, 264.071
CIE-LUV 39.194, -24.134, -48.712
Hunter-Lab 32.821, -4.222, -30.459
Binary 00001101, 01100001, 10010100

Shades and Tints of #0d6194

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000204 is the darkest color, while #f1f9f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#0d6194

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4b5256 is the less saturated color, while #0164a0 is the most saturated one.
